### Changelog — Keyturner 2.8 (changed defaults)

Keyturner, our internal secrets-rotation utility, now rotates database credentials every 14 days instead of 30, and dry-run mode is enabled by default on first install to prevent accidental rotations in shared environments. Grace windows for dual-validity were lengthened after last month's incident. The new shipped defaults, effective for all fresh installs, are as follows.

deployment values, faduf-tawep:
SORDOR_LOG_LEVEL=error
SORDOR_METRICS_HOST=metrics.sordor.nelvrolabs.internal
SORDOR_POOL_SIZE=4

Subject: Renewal of the Calverton Metals Supply Contract

Dear Board Members,

Our three-year agreement with Calverton Metals expires at quarter-end. Procurement has negotiated improved volume discounts and firmer delivery guarantees, offset by a modest indexation clause. Given Calverton's reliability and the limited alternatives in the Rothmere corridor, management recommends renewal. Full terms are attached for your review. Our broader sourcing intentions are summarized below.

management briefing: The renewal with Zoraelax Group closes at $10 million a year, 15 percent below the last contract. Project Ralael slips by six weeks because of the audit delay.

### Step 3: Switch to the new scrubber

Support team, this one's easy: point uploads at ExifWipe v2 instead of the legacy scrubber. The new version strips GPS and serial tags by default, so fewer privacy tickets. Old jobs drain automatically within an hour. Once switched, confirm the service started with the configuration values below.

deployment values, yagug-tafop:
ralael:
  log_level: error
  metrics_host: metrics.ralael.qorvelsys.internal
  pin: 7257
  pool_size: 32